Commit graph

3603 commits

Author SHA1 Message Date
Abdul Basit
aa17b8eba4
[detector] Implemented Box Detector (#3242)
* Implemented a box detector with test cases.

* corrected comments

* remove generic keyword for box detector
remove PII details of user.

* Added Box Oauth detector
Implemented description for Box detectors.
Separated out test for Box detectors.

* removed user information from ExtraData.

---------

Co-authored-by: 0x1 <13666360+0x1@users.noreply.github.com>
2024-10-15 08:42:37 -05:00
Richard Gomez
34e443adcf
feat: propagate file info in log context (#3405) 2024-10-14 17:13:39 -07:00
renovate[bot]
e6281ca641
fix(deps): update module github.com/xanzy/go-gitlab to v0.112.0 (#3410)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2024-10-14 17:11:56 -07:00
renovate[bot]
e62939fb6e
fix(deps): update module github.com/getsentry/sentry-go to v0.29.1 (#3408)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2024-10-14 13:21:07 -07:00
renovate[bot]
eb8dc53f5e
fix(deps): update module github.com/gabriel-vasile/mimetype to v1.4.6 (#3407)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2024-10-14 12:55:41 -07:00
Kyle Dodson
cf54b71a94
Update SaladCloud description (#3399) 2024-10-11 15:55:29 -07:00
ahrav
67a3b6df35
fix tests (#3400) 2024-10-11 13:14:03 -07:00
Miccah
fe97978143
[chore] Update custom detector default description (#3398) 2024-10-11 11:49:23 -07:00
Zachary Rice
3ac63414a2
add description to salad (#3397) 2024-10-11 11:55:38 -05:00
Kyle Dodson
58485f3395
Add detector for SaladCloud API Keys (#3273) 2024-10-10 21:23:25 -07:00
renovate[bot]
8b2b98695b
fix(deps): update module github.com/xanzy/go-gitlab to v0.111.0 (#3393)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2024-10-10 13:39:47 -07:00
Bill Rich
5280c3877c
Add SliceContainsString common util (#3395)
* Add SliceContainsString common util

* Include slice index and string match from slice
2024-10-10 13:23:23 -07:00
JonZeolla
02d17cae25
fix: pr template link to golangci-lint (#3392) 2024-10-10 10:57:41 -07:00
renovate[bot]
f44e623de3
fix(deps): update golang.org/x/exp digest to f66d83c (#3389)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2024-10-10 07:58:57 -07:00
Richard Gomez
05015b38f6
Separate detector tests into unit/integration (#3274)
* test: split unit and integration tests

* test: split railway unit/integration

* test(alchemy): add new case
2024-10-10 08:47:40 -05:00
ahrav
e57c712998
Manually upgrade github dep (#3387) 2024-10-10 06:16:40 -07:00
Kashif Khan
bc32592066
Updated Fastly Personal Token Detector (#3386)
* Updated verification API and enhanced the code for fastly personal token detector

* fixed integration test cases and resolved comments

* pass secret to SetVerificationError
2024-10-10 07:50:30 -05:00
renovate[bot]
6f1a717d0e
fix(deps): update module google.golang.org/api to v0.200.0 (#3391)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2024-10-09 17:54:09 -07:00
Abdul Basit
76ca171765
[Fix] Snowflake privatelink Support (#3286)
* [Fixes]
- handling of `.privatelink` in account identifier
- added unit test for pattern detection.
- fixes hard coded account and username in test.

* variable name fixes
2024-10-09 09:54:14 -05:00
Kashif Khan
321813fe75
Enhanced the easyinsight detector (#3384)
* Enhanced the easyinsight detector

* restructured verification code and resolved comments

* resolved comments

* added basic auth

* updated statuscode logic
2024-10-09 09:52:28 -05:00
Richard Gomez
23afcd77ee
Log skipped files on debug level (#3383) 2024-10-07 20:39:06 -07:00
Richard Gomez
dcf8363eaa
build: update retracted bluemonday ver (#3369)
Co-authored-by: Zachary Rice <zachary.rice@trufflesec.com>
2024-10-07 16:30:02 -07:00
Dustin Decker
59c615a5e9
Fix git binary handling and add a smoke test (#3379)
* Fix git binary handling and add a smoke test

* hide stdout

* add failure case to smoke test

* run again with deadlock fix

* Add logic to drain reader in the event of an error

* add tests

* be picky

* set author identity

* suppress linter

---------

Co-authored-by: Ahrav Dutta <ahrav.dutta@trufflesec.com>
2024-10-07 13:55:07 -07:00
renovate[bot]
57802abf52
fix(deps): update module google.golang.org/protobuf to v1.35.1 (#3382)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2024-10-07 10:32:24 -07:00
Kashif Khan
ce5da505a7
Added Cisco Meraki API Key detector (#3367)
* Added cisco meraki apikey detector

* addressed the comments

* handled api response and saving orgs data in extra data

* fixed linter

---------

Co-authored-by: Zachary Rice <zachary.rice@trufflesec.com>
2024-10-07 12:00:45 -05:00
Kashif Khan
23e8ae4a1e
improved the agora detector (#3360)
* improved the agora detector

* updated prefix keywords and test cases

---------

Co-authored-by: Zachary Rice <zachary.rice@trufflesec.com>
2024-10-07 11:39:54 -05:00
renovate[bot]
40fdf44073
fix(deps): update module github.com/xanzy/go-gitlab to v0.110.0 (#3376)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2024-10-06 08:37:39 -07:00
renovate[bot]
a35bea0c49
fix(deps): update golang.org/x/exp digest to 225e2ab (#3371)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2024-10-06 08:22:33 -07:00
renovate[bot]
99dd43c950
fix(deps): update module golang.org/x/net to v0.30.0 (#3373)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2024-10-05 11:17:56 -07:00
renovate[bot]
a980713984
fix(deps): update module golang.org/x/crypto to v0.28.0 (#3372)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2024-10-05 11:17:34 -07:00
renovate[bot]
d590129c83
chore(deps): update sigstore/cosign-installer action to v3.7.0 (#3368)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2024-10-05 09:28:03 -07:00
renovate[bot]
8b360ca63d
fix(deps): update module cloud.google.com/go/storage to v1.44.0 (#3366)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2024-10-05 09:27:34 -07:00
renovate[bot]
dcf36f6d15
fix(deps): update module github.com/schollz/progressbar/v3 to v3.16.1 (#3365)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2024-10-05 09:27:10 -07:00
ahrav
c98c092a71
[refactor] - Decouple Metrics From Cache Implementation (#3355)
* decouple metrics from cache logic

* delete

* address comments

* update
2024-10-04 13:25:10 -07:00
renovate[bot]
1e5b831d16
fix(deps): update module github.com/snowflakedb/gosnowflake to v1.11.2 (#3363)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2024-10-03 13:53:23 -07:00
Bhodi
2830bed00b
Updated Cosign Install URL (#3364) 2024-10-03 14:12:58 -05:00
renovate[bot]
901fdff992
fix(deps): update module github.com/jedib0t/go-pretty/v6 to v6.6.0 (#3361)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2024-10-03 07:24:47 -07:00
Kashif Khan
a4cc5f7cc3
Added Pattern test cases for detectors (#3354)
* Added Pattern test cases for detectors

* restructured the unit tests

* Added pattern test cases for few more detectors

* Added pattern test case for 3 more detectors

* formatted testing patterns
2024-10-02 10:44:47 -07:00
ahrav
04eae7af42
remove size check (#3351) 2024-10-02 08:27:33 -07:00
renovate[bot]
93c8c95812
fix(deps): update module go.mongodb.org/mongo-driver to v1.17.1 (#3357)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2024-10-02 08:22:00 -07:00
ahrav
b63d6c02a7
[chore] - Rename memory cache package to 'simple' for clarity (#3352)
* rename memory to cache

* Update

* fix imports
2024-10-02 07:48:26 -07:00
Kashif Khan
effee2a912
Fixed github oauth2 token detector (#3353) 2024-10-01 04:07:22 -07:00
ahrav
a5b09951c1
[feat] - Add SizedLRU Cache (#3344)
* add impl for lru sized cache

* update error message

* address comments

* rename

* update comments
2024-09-30 13:18:15 -07:00
ahrav
350db3a11e
[bug] - Recover From Panic During Archive Handling (#3348)
* recover from panic

* clarify comment
2024-09-30 12:45:20 -07:00
ahrav
3dff283bb2
[fix] - Use Parent Context in Azure Detector (#3346)
* use context

* sort imports
2024-09-30 12:13:04 -07:00
ahrav
5f3b4521d7
[chore] - update Go version to 1.23.0 (#3340)
* update Go version to 1.23.0

* update go version across the rest of the project
2024-09-27 09:55:15 -07:00
Zachary Rice
8cb5e98804
disable secret scans for community PRs (#3343)
* disable secret scans for community PRs

* check if fork too
2024-09-27 11:55:04 -05:00
Kashif Khan
49cb9d395d
Enhanced the eraser detector to handle new status code from verification API (#3342) 2024-09-27 11:32:58 -05:00
ahrav
ee51fc5cc4
[feat] - Add Generic Hasher Interface with Blake2b Implementation (#3337)
* Add hasher interface and fnv + sha256 implemenations

* update

* remove

* fix test

* update

* remove

* remove

* fix spelling
2024-09-26 20:11:42 -07:00
Miccah
0328a19a9d
[fix] Move detector initialization to DefaultDetectors function (#3341) 2024-09-26 14:03:24 -07:00